T.O. practices but Ware doesn't
The Breerman reports in on the DMN blog:
WR Terrell Owens was there, yes. And he had a limp in his step, favoring the left ankle he injured in Carolina. He was rounding out his breaks, rather than changing direction sharp, on most routes. Toward the end, he seemed to be accelerating and cutting better.
But then there’s this cryptic entry later:
One omission from my practice report was the absence of Cowboys OLB DeMarcus Ware.
He wasn't there. We'll pass along more as it becomes available.
What’s up with that?
